What Is Bipolar Disorder?

Bipolar disorder, formerly known as manic-depressive illness, involves extreme mood swings—ranging from emotional highs (mania or hypomania) to lows (depression). It affects people across all age groups, including adolescents and adults. Common symptoms include:

  • Periods of intense happiness or irritability

  • Increased energy or activity

  • Trouble sleeping

  • Risky behavior during manic phases

  • Feelings of sadness, hopelessness, and fatigue during depressive episodes

Types of Bipolar Disorder

Understanding the different types of bipolar disorder is essential for getting the right treatment. There are several subtypes, each with its own pattern of mood episodes:

1. Bipolar I Disorder

Characterized by at least one full manic episode that may be preceded or followed by a depressive episode. The manic phase can be severe and may require hospitalization. This is the most intense form of bipolar disorder.

2. Bipolar II Disorder

Involves at least one major depressive episode and one hypomanic episode (a milder form of mania). People with Bipolar II often experience longer periods of depression, which can significantly affect daily life.

3. Cyclothymic Disorder (Cyclothymia)

A milder form of bipolar disorder involving chronic mood fluctuations. While the highs and lows are less severe than full mania or depression, they persist for at least two years in adults (one year in children and adolescents).

4. Other Specified and Unspecified Bipolar and Related Disorders

These include bipolar symptoms that don’t exactly match the criteria for the above types but still cause significant distress or impairment. They are often diagnosed when mood symptoms are clearly bipolar in nature but don’t meet the duration or intensity required for a specific category.

Understanding the type of bipolar disorder you have helps in choosing the right treatment and improving long-term outcomes.

1. Psychiatric Evaluation and Medication Management

Psychiatrists in Islamabad and Rawalpindi can provide accurate diagnoses and prescribe mood stabilizers, antipsychotics, or antidepressants as needed. Regular follow-ups help adjust treatment for maximum benefit.

2.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T)

CBT is one of the most effective talk therapies for bipolar disorder. Mental health clinics across Islamabad and Rawalpindi offer CBT to help patients manage negative thoughts, track mood changes, and develop coping skills.

3. Family and Couples Therapy

Family involvement improves treatment outcomes significantly. Many clinics now provide family-based therapy to help relatives understand the condition and support recovery.

4. Psychoeducation and Support Groups

Awareness and education sessions about bipolar disorder can help patients and their families make informed decisions. Local therapists often hold support groups in Islamabad and Rawalpindi that reduce isolation and offer community support.
